Why do my vertical blinds not turn?

Slats which won't rotate are a sign that something is wrong with your tilter mechanism. Take your blind off the window and lie it on a flat surface so you can look inside the headrail. If you have a chain pulley system, examine the chain control mechanism and make sure the chain hasn't come off the sprocket wheel.

What are vertical blinds made of?

These panels, called vanes, tilt open and closed, as well as pull from side to side. Vanes are typically 3 ½” wide and are made from vinyl, PVC, fabric, aluminum or wood. Vertical blinds hang from a track and are adjustable to allow in varying amounts of light.

When were vertical blinds popular?

It was thought vertical blinds would be much easier to clean. They became very popular in the 1960’s when large sliding glass patio doors gained prominence. They have remained a favorite choice today for those looking for a simple and often inexpensive way to cover large windows.

How to shorten a cord on a vane?

If you look inside the headrail you will find the vane carrier where the cord ends in a knot. Hold that carrier and pull out the excess cord until the cord safety device reaches the desired height. Next, tie a knot in the cord at that position, but do not cut off the excess at this point.

How to remove a vane?

Vane is out of alignment. When you want to remove a vane, slide a thin flat object (credit card, etc.) up the vane on the hook side of the vane holder. Then slide the vane and card down and out of the vane holder ( vane should slide out easily).

What to do if your blinds don't rotate?

If your blinds don’t rotate or are difficult to open, they may need some lubrication. Pick up a lubricant spray that can be used on items around the house (like WD-40 or silicone spray). Spray a bit of lubricant where the rod is connected to the blinds and that’s it! Rotation issues and stubborn blinds fixed!

Why won't my blinds turn?

Sometimes it’s not the panels’ fault; they won’t turn because there is a small object lodged up there. Check if there is something (dirt or even a broken piece of your panel) jammed in the slots where the blinds are connected with the carrier stem.
